Ever wondered how people from different walks of life find their way to sobriety? This episode of Sober Cast brings you two incredible stories of recovery that are as diverse as they are inspiring. Sarah, with two years of sobriety under her belt, kicks things off with a raw and honest ten-minute share.

She talks about her early struggles with addiction, her double life as a straight-A student by day and a troubled teen by night, and how she finally found her way to sobriety. Her journey is a powerful reminder that no matter how far you've strayed, there's always a way back. Then, Roni takes the stage, sharing her experience of 31 years in recovery.

Her story is equally gripping, detailing her battles with addiction, the impact on her family, and how she eventually turned her life around. Roni's wisdom and humour shine through as she talks about the importance of community, the power of the 12 steps, and the daily commitment to staying sober. This episode is not just about the struggles; it's about the triumphs, the little victories, and the strength found in vulnerability.

Whether you're new to sobriety or have been on this path for years, Sarah and Roni's stories offer valuable insights and hope. Tune in to hear these compelling narratives that prove recovery is possible for anyone, no matter where they start.
